Software Engineer – HPC Team
Siemens Digital Industries Software is a leading provider of solutions for the design, simulation, and manufacture of products across many different industries. Formula 1 cars, skyscrapers, ships, space exploration vehicles, and many of the objects we see in our daily lives are being conceived and manufactured using our software.
We're hiring a Software Engineer to join our HPC team (part of the AIDEC Business Line). You will help evolve HPCWorks, ensuring our workload manager integration and cloud deployment capabilities remain industry-leading. You’ll make a difference by:- Distributed Microservices Design:
Designing and implementing microservice roles, responsibilities, and interactions within Nav Ops, ensuring scalability and resilience. - Technology Watch:
Staying ahead of microservice patterns, including event‑driven architectures, and implementing best practices. - Documentation‑As‑Code:
Defining and implementing a developer‑friendly software documentation strategy, leveraging automation and best practices. - Testing Advocate:
Designing and implementing robust unit, contract, integration, and end‑to‑end testing strategies. - Lead User Stories:
Defining and prioritizing development tasks, ensuring seamless alignment with business and technical goals. - Contribute to Nav Ops Development:
Playing a critical role in advancing core libraries and features within the Nav Ops platform. - Document Architecture:
Maintaining and evolving technical documentation, ensuring clarity and accessibility for developers. - Monitor and Maintain CI:
Overseeing continuous integration pipelines to enhance software quality and development efficiency.
- Strong proficiency in Go (Java or Rust), with hands‑on experience in microservices development.
- Proven expertise with Linux‑based operating systems, including command‑line usage and shell scripting.
- Expertise in using and developing container‑based applications (i.e. Docker, Kubernetes, etc.).
- Expertise in event‑driven architectures and cloud‑native development.
- Knowledge of CI/CD pipelines and Dev Ops methodologies.
- Strong documentation skills, with experience in "Documentation‑As‑Code" practices.
- High Performance Computing (HPC) knowledge/experience is desirable.
